How to Make Creamy Sausage Tortellini Soup
- STEP 1: Heat 2 tablespoons of olive oil in a large pot over medium heat.
- STEP 2: Add 1 pound of Italian sausage to the pot and cook, breaking it up into smaller pieces with a spoon, until browned.
- STEP 3: Add 1 diced onion and 3 cloves of minced garlic to the pot. Cook until the onion is softened and translucent, stirring occasionally to prevent burning.
- STEP 4: Pour in 6 cups of chicken broth, 1 teaspoon of dried basil, 1 teaspoon of dried oregano, 1 teaspoon of salt, and 1/2 teaspoon of black pepper. Stir well to combine all the ingredients.
- STEP 5: Bring the soup to a boil, then reduce the heat to low and let it simmer for 15 minutes to allow the flavors to meld together.
- STEP 6: Stir in 1 cup of heavy cream, gently incorporating it into the soup. Bring the soup back to a simmer.
- STEP 7: Add a 9-ounce package of refrigerated cheese tortellini to the pot and cook according to the package instructions, usually about 7-9 minutes or until the tortellini is tender.
- STEP 8: Once the tortellini is cooked, toss in 2 cups of fresh spinach leaves. Stir until the spinach wilts and integrates into the soup.
- STEP 9: Taste the creamy sausage tortellini soup and adjust the seasoning with salt and pepper, if needed, to suit your preferences.
- STEP 10: Serve the piping hot creamy sausage tortellini soup in bowls, and top each serving with a generous sprinkle of grated Parmesan cheese for an extra burst of flavor. Enjoy this comforting and satisfying dish!

How to Store Creamy Sausage Tortellini Soup
After preparing a pot of delicious Creamy Sausage Tortellini Soup, you may find yourself with leftovers that you want to enjoy later. Fear not, as this soup stores well and retains its flavors beautifully for future indulgence.
One simple method to store the soup is in airtight containers in the refrigerator. Once the soup has completely cooled, transfer it to containers with a tight seal to prevent any odors from permeating the dish. Properly stored, Creamy Sausage Tortellini Soup can last in the refrigerator for up to 3-4 days, allowing you to savor the flavors over multiple meals.
For longer-term storage, consider freezing portions of the soup. Freezing Creamy Sausage Tortellini Soup can help extend its shelf life for up to 2-3 months. Divide the cooled soup into freezer-safe containers, leaving some space at the top to account for expansion during freezing. When ready to enjoy, simply thaw the frozen soup in the refrigerator overnight and reheat it gently on the stove, stirring occasionally to ensure even warming.
Alternatively, if you prefer a quicker reheating method, you can defrost the frozen soup in the microwave, using short intervals to prevent overheating. Stir the soup intermittently to distribute the heat evenly and enjoy a steaming bowl of Creamy Sausage Tortellini Soup in no time.

Note
- For a lighter version, you can use turkey sausage and substitute half-and-half or milk for the heavy cream.
- Feel free to add extra vegetables like diced carrots, celery, or bell peppers for added flavor and nutrition.
- If you prefer a thicker soup, you can mix a tablespoon of cornstarch with a little water and add it to the soup during the simmering process.
- To enhance the flavor, consider sprinkling some red pepper flakes or freshly chopped herbs like parsley or basil before serving.
- This soup can be easily reheated, but it's best consumed fresh as the tortellini may become soggy upon reheating.
